
Prepare for your next Cae Engineer interview in 2025 with expert-picked questions, explanations, and sample answers.
Interviewing for a Cae Engineer position involves demonstrating a strong understanding of computer-aided engineering principles, software tools, and analytical skills. Candidates should be prepared to discuss their technical expertise, problem-solving abilities, and experience with simulation and modeling. The interview may include technical assessments, behavioral questions, and discussions about past projects.
Expectations for a Cae Engineer interview include showcasing your proficiency in software like ANSYS, Abaqus, or SolidWorks, as well as your ability to analyze complex engineering problems. Challenges may arise in articulating technical concepts clearly and demonstrating how your skills align with the company's needs. Key competencies include anal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ication.
In a Cae Engineer interview, candidates can expect a mix of technical, behavioral, and situational questions. Technical questions will assess your knowledge of engineering principles and software tools, while behavioral questions will explore your past experiences and how you handle challenges. Situational questions may present hypothetical scenarios to evaluate your problem-solving skills.
Technical questions for Cae Engineers often focus on specific software tools, engineering principles, and methodologies. Candidates may be asked to explain their experience with finite element analysis (FEA), computational fluid dynamics (CFD), or other simulation techniques. It's essential to demonstrate not only your technical knowledge but also your ability to apply it in real-world scenarios. Be prepared to discuss specific projects where you utilized these skills, including the challenges faced and the outcomes achieved.
Behavioral questions in a Cae Engineer interview aim to understand how you approach challenges, work in teams, and communicate with stakeholders. Candidates may be asked to describe a time when they faced a significant engineering problem and how they resolved it. Using the STAR (Situation, Task, Action, Result) method can help structure your responses effectively. Highlighting your collaboration with cross-functional teams and your ability to adapt to changing project requirements will be crucial.
Situational questions present hypothetical scenarios that a Cae Engineer might encounter in their role. For example, you may be asked how you would approach a project with tight deadlines or how you would handle conflicting feedback from team members. These questions assess your critical thinking and decision-making skills. It's important to demonstrate a logical approach to problem-solving and to consider the implications of your decisions on project outcomes.
Questions about your project experience will delve into specific engineering projects you've worked on. Be prepared to discuss the objectives, methodologies, and results of these projects. Highlight your role in the project, the tools you used, and any challenges you overcame. This is an opportunity to showcase your hands-on experience and the impact of your contributions on project success.
Interviewers may also ask about current trends and advancements in the field of computer-aided engineering. Staying informed about emerging technologies, software updates, and industry best practices is essential. Be prepared to discuss how these trends could influence your work as a Cae Engineer and how you plan to adapt to changes in the industry.

Track Interviews for FreeI am proficient in several software tools, including ANSYS for finite element analysis, Abaqus for advanced simulations, and SolidWorks for 3D modeling. I have used these tools extensively in various projects to analyze structural integrity and optimize designs.
How to Answer ItWhen answering, mention specific software tools and your level of proficiency. Highlight any certifications or training you've completed.
In a recent project, we faced significant time constraints while developing a new product. I implemented a streamlined simulation process, which allowed us to identify design flaws early. This proactive approach saved us time and resources, leading to a successful product launch.
How to Answer ItUse the STAR method to structure your response, focusing on the situation, your actions, and the results achieved.
I ensure accuracy by validating my models against experimental data and using appropriate mesh refinement techniques. Regularly reviewing and updating my simulation parameters also helps maintain accuracy throughout the project.
How to Answer ItDiscuss specific techniques you use to validate your work and ensure accuracy in your simulations.
I have over five years of experience with FEA, primarily using ANSYS. I have applied FEA to analyze stress distribution in complex structures and optimize designs for performance and safety.
How to Answer ItHighlight your experience level and specific applications of FEA in your previous roles.
I regularly attend industry conferences, participate in webinars, and follow relevant publications to stay informed about the latest trends and technologies in CAE. Networking with other professionals also provides valuable insights.
How to Answer ItMention specific resources or activities you engage in to keep your knowledge current.

A strong Cae Engineer candidate typically holds a degree in mechanical engineering or a related field, with relevant certifications in CAE software. Ideally, they have 3-5 years of experience in the industry, demonstrating proficiency in simulation tools and methodologies. Essential soft skills include problem-solving, effective communication, and teamwork, as collaboration with cross-functional teams is crucial in this role. A successful candidate should also exhibit a strong analytical mindset and the ability to adapt to new technologies and processes.
Technical proficiency is vital for a Cae Engineer, as it directly impacts the quality of simulations and analyses performed. A candidate should be well-versed in software like ANSYS, Abaqus, or SolidWorks, enabling them to execute complex simulations accurately and efficiently.
Problem-solving skills are essential for navigating the challenges that arise during engineering projects. A strong candidate should demonstrate the ability to identify issues, analyze data, and develop effective solutions, ensuring project success and innovation.
Effective communication is crucial for a Cae Engineer, as they must convey complex technical information to non-technical stakeholders. A candidate should be able to articulate their findings clearly and collaborate with team members to achieve project goals.
Attention to detail is critical in CAE, as even minor errors can lead to significant consequences in simulations. A strong candidate should demonstrate meticulousness in their work, ensuring accuracy and reliability in their analyses.
Adaptability is important in the ever-evolving field of engineering. A successful Cae Engineer should be open to learning new tools and methodologies, allowing them to stay current with industry trends and enhance their skill set.
